What kind of birth control is drospirenone and ethinyl estradiol?

DROSPIRENONE; ETHINYL ESTRADIOL (dro SPY re nown; ETH in il es tra DYE ole) is an oral contraceptive (birth control pill). This medicine combines two types of female hormones, an estrogen and a progestin. It is used to prevent ovulation and pregnancy.

How does levonorgestrel and ethinyl estradiol work?

Levonorgestrel and ethinyl estradiol combination is used to prevent pregnancy. It works by stopping a woman’s egg from fully developing each month. The egg can no longer accept a sperm and fertilization (pregnancy) is prevented. No contraceptive method is 100 percent effective.

Is drospirenone a progesterone?

Drospirenone is one of several different progestins that are used in birth control pills. Most birth control pills (combination oral contraceptives) combine a synthetic version of the female hormone progesterone (referred to as a progestin) with a synthetic version of the female hormone estrogen.

Can Yaz make you gain weight?

Yes. Yaz may cause weight gain in some women. Based on a trial in women with premenstrual dysphoric disorder (PMDD), around 2.5% of those taking Yaz experienced weight gain. This side effect may be enough for some women to choose a different contraceptive pill.

What does drospirenone do to your body?

1 mg 17beta-estradiol/2 mg drospirenone has unique antimineralocorticoid properties, which can be attributed to drospirenone. This combination prevents salt and water retention elicited by estrogens, and thereby prevents increases in blood pressure and maintains a stable body weight.

Is drospirenone good for weight loss?

Women receiving hormone therapy with 1 mg 17beta-estradiol/2 mg drospirenone had either no weight change or a small decrease, while those receiving estradiol alone tended to increase in weight. Mean body weight after 1 year of treatment with 1 mg 17beta-estradiol/2 mg drospirenone decreased by 1.2 kg (p < 0.001).

Can drospirenone cause hair loss?

Progestins with a low androgen index include drospirenone, norgestimate, and cyproterone. They do not cause hair loss when you take them, but they can cause hair loss when you stop them because they cause a rebound surge in androgens and androgen sensitivity.

Can drospirenone cause infertility?

The short answer is no. Women who have used hormonal birth control are just as likely to conceive as women who have never used hormonal contraceptives. A three-year study of 3,727 participants found that long-term use of oral contraceptives did not affect their ability to have children in the future.

How do I know if levonorgestrel is working?

How will I know if Levonorgestrel tablets worked? Most women will have their next menstrual period at the expected time or within a week of the expected time. If your menstrual period is delayed beyond 1 week, you may be pregnant. You should get a pregnancy test and follow up with your healthcare professional.
